Recently, the CEO of Nvidia, Jensen Huang, was asked about a story claiming he said China would beat the U.S. in the AI race. His response was not what many expected. He clarified that he did not say China would win. Instead, he highlighted that China has extremely strong AI capabilities, with a huge number of talented researchers. In fact, he pointed out that half of the world’s AI researchers are based in China. They are developing very advanced AI models, some of which are among the most popular open-source models in the world. Because of this, he emphasized that the United States must continue to innovate incredibly quickly to keep pace. The world is very competitive, and in such an environment, everyone must run fast.
